2026 Bennington QX Series 28 QXFBWAX1

Description

Dressed in ****, the 2026 Bennington QX Series 28 QXFBWAX1 shows up like the VIP section of the lake—bold, polished, and ready to make every outing feel like an event. As a **pontoon** built to be a true **pinnacle of luxury**, it’s designed for the kind of days that start with “just a quick cruise” and somehow turn into an all-day float with your favorite people.
At **31.2 feet (9.5 m)** long with a confident **120-inch (3 m) beam**, this is a big, stable platform for fun, built on an **aluminum** hull with **three pontoons**—including substantial **32-inch** pontoon diameter—so the ride feels composed when the water gets busy and the guest list gets long. And with capacity for **up to 18 passengers**, you can bring the whole crew without playing seating Tetris. There’s room to lounge across **four cockpit sofas**, stretch out in the bow with **eight open-bow seats**, and still keep the captain comfortable in a dedicated **helm chair**, plus an extra **cockpit chair** for whoever’s acting as co-pilot.
The helm is set up for easy, confident control: **remote outboard steering**, **steering assist**, and a **power trim system** make dialing in your ride feel effortless. Out back, **outboard** power with **fuel injection** (no carburetor fuss here—this one is **fuel injected**) delivers crisp response, with flexibility ranging from a **minimum recommended 90 hp** all the way up to a **maximum recommended 600 hp**. Pair that with **propeller** propulsion and a **2.15:1** gear ratio, and you’ve got a setup made for everything from relaxed cruising to lively lake runs.
When the sun’s high, the **Bimini top** brings the shade; when the breeze picks up, the **walk-through windshield** helps keep the cockpit comfortable. Underfoot, **vinyl flooring** is ready for wet feet, sandy toes, and snack spills. And when it’s time to set the soundtrack, the **Rockford Fosgate®** system with **Bluetooth® audio** keeps the vibe on point.
Top it off with a generous **116-gallon (409 L)** fuel capacity and a **fuel level gauge** to keep tabs on the fun, and this Bennington is basically a floating “yes” to making more plans on the water.

  • Pricing

  • Basic Warranty (Months): 120
  • Engine

  • Engine Type: In-Line
  • Cylinders: 4
  • Horsepower: 90 bhp; 67.2 kW
  • Full Throttle RPM Range Low: 5000
  • Full Throttle RPM Range High: 6000
  • Cooling: Water (Open Loop)
  • Bore: 81 mm; 3.19 in
  • Stroke: 88.9 mm; 3.5 in
  • Displacement: 1832 cc; 111.8 ci
  • Compression Ratio: 10.0:1
  • Starter: Electric
  • Alternator Amps: 35
  • Fuel Type: Gas
  • Carburetion Type: Fuel Injected
  • Drive Line

  • Gear Ratio(s): 2.15:1
  • Counter Rotating Capable: No
  • Trim System: Standard
  • Trim System Type: Power
  • Technical Specifications

  • Length: 375 in; 9500 mm
  • Beam: 120 in; 3 m
  • Number Of Pontoons: 3
  • Number of Passengers: 18
  • Fuel Capacity: 116 gal; 409 l
  • Exterior

  • Hull Material: Aluminum
  • Steering

  • Outboard Steering Control: Remote
  • Instrumentation

  • Speedometer: Standard
  • Tachometer: Standard
  • Glass

  • Windshield: Standard
